H5-3

ca. 1934. Entrance through small covered porch to brick and half-timbered Tudor-style house, residence of William E. and Pearl T. Weeks. Porch feature is three turned wood posts. Address was formerly 3716 No. Mason Ave.

H5-1

ca. 1934. Exterior of ivy-covered brick and half-timbered Tudor-style house, residence of William E. and Pearl T. Weeks. Built in 1926, contractor W. G. Clark. Woman standing on lawn in front of house. Address formerly was 3716 No. Mason Ave.

H5-2

ca. 1934. Entrance to brick and half-timbered Tudor-style house. Unusual roofing material which appears to be multiple, varigated sizes of wood shingles. Residence of William E. and Pearl T. Weeks. (Argentum)
